**Q: What should I know before using the Tillgate CSV Import Wizard?**

The wizard validates headers, infers column types from the first 200 rows, and quarantines malformed records rather than rejecting the whole file. Always review the quarantine summary before committing. Contractors do not have standing write access; to commit an import you must unseal the contractor staging vault, which requires the passphrase shown below.

vault phrase of bagaf-kajeg = jorath-feniel-briir-siliel-ralix

# Break-Glass: Catalog Cache Invalidation

Scope: the Pinrow product catalog at Veldstone Retail. If stale prices persist after a purge and the Hollowmere invalidation queue is wedged, use break-glass to flush the edge tier directly. Contractors: get verbal sign-off from the catalog lead first. Steps: open the Hollowmere admin shell, select emergency-flush, confirm the tenant, and run it once — repeated flushes thrash the origin. Access is logged and expires after 20 minutes. Unseal the admin shell with the passphrase below.

recovery phrase for kahop-tajog: istix-casvan

## Stackfeed Environments

Stackfeed publishes parking-garage occupancy counts from the Delmore garages every thirty seconds. There are three environments: dev, staging, and production. Dev uses a simulated feed; staging and production read from live sensors. As a contractor you'll mostly work in staging, which mirrors production except for polling intervals and queue names. The staging environment uses the following configuration.

deployment values, kajep-kageg:
[praix]
host = praix.paliqcorp.corp
user = praix_svc
database = praix_prod

Handover: FareForge rules engine (shipping fees)

State: stable, one open issue. Rule evaluation order changed last Tuesday — zone surcharges now apply before weight brackets, so some quotes shifted a few cents. Support will see tickets about this; point customers to the updated fee schedule. Known bug: bulk-discount rule ignores oversized items; fix lands next release. Don't edit rules directly in prod; use the staging sandbox. The rule catalog, test steps, and escalation path are all documented on the internal page.

runbook for tajep-yahig: https://artifactory.lumictech.corp/repo